There are various forms of runes and magickal writings that exist and can be used somewhat sucessfully for magickal purposes. One thing that people tend to forget, especially with Runes, is that simply writing an English phrase into Runes does not instantly make it magickal.
For example - I have need to write down words for a spell, so I decide to use some runes:

And boy does that look cool and magicky! However, all it says is "This is a spell" in a Rune font I downloaded.

The better way to use runes is to learn about their deeper meanings. Each one is
thought to represent a particular "thing" (be it love, power, wealth, strength, fertility etc) and is closer to a historically correct use of the symbols.
If you wish to write so that few(er) people are likely to understand what you have written the it is possible to use runes or other magickal scripts in order to keep things private, then that's a different thing completely.
